Japanese Government Scholarships (Teachers Training Students)

This program is for in-service teachers from the selected education boards in India only.
The Embassy has already contacted those education boards.

APPLICATION GUIDELINES FOR 2023(TEACHERS TRAINING STUDENTS)

Type Teacher Training Students
Level Masters level leading to Certificate
Age Under 35 (born on or after April 2, 1988)
Fields of study Education
Qualification Applicants who have worked as teachers in primary or secondary schools for at least 5 years
Term of scholarship One and a half year from October
Number of scholarships Up to 9
Stipend 143,000 Yen/ month (Approx. Rs. 101,400 / month)
Tuition fees Exempted
Airfare Round-trip airfare will be provided
Application procedure Applications from schools other than CBSE, KVS, DBSE and NVS can be sent directly to Japan Information Centre, Embassy of Japan
Preliminary Selection Document Screening
Written Test and Online Interview (in February)
Application deadline January 27, 2023
